Inventory Write-Down — Kestrel Range (Managers Only)

Following the Q2 count, we are writing down roughly 18% of remaining Kestrel-series stock across the Northfield and Arbor Cross branches. The units affected failed the updated moisture-resistance spec and cannot be sold at full price. Branch managers should quarantine flagged pallets and await disposal instructions. Do not discuss figures with floor staff. For context, note the following:

internal memo for hahif-hahaf: Headcount on the Zorwyn team goes from 9 to 100 by the end of October. Gross margin on Zorwyn came in at 5 percent against a plan of 10 percent.

# Break-Glass: Catalog Cache Invalidation

Scope: the Pinrow product catalog at Veldstone Retail. If stale prices persist after a purge and the Hollowmere invalidation queue is wedged, use break-glass to flush the edge tier directly. Contractors: get verbal sign-off from the catalog lead first. Steps: open the Hollowmere admin shell, select emergency-flush, confirm the tenant, and run it once — repeated flushes thrash the origin. Access is logged and expires after 20 minutes. Unseal the admin shell with the passphrase below.

recovery phrase for kahop-tajog: istix-casvan

## Who to ping about GiftNote

Welcome aboard! GiftNote is our donation-receipt mailer for the Larchfield Fund. Template tweaks go to the comms folks; delivery failures and bounce weirdness go to the platform crew. Don't push template changes on Fridays — receipts batch over the weekend. For anything GiftNote-related, start with the address below.

billing contact of kaweg-tajeg = drudor.lamion.oliath@torvalabs.test

MEMO — Q4 Cash-Flow Forecast

To: Department Heads
From: Finance, Orvane Systems

Operating inflows tracking 4% under plan. Receivables from the Pellwick contract slipped one quarter. Capex frozen except safety items. Submit revised spend plans by Tuesday. No exceptions. Further context on the drivers sits in the confidential note below.

board note of fahif-yahog: Gross margin on Wenath came in at 10 percent against a plan of 5 percent. Only 3 of the 100 pilot accounts renewed Wenath, so a churn review is set for July 15.